Eddig is sok minden szólt a PWA mellett, de van egy újabb trend, ami mellett nem mehetünk el. De előtte, mi is az a PWA?
Progressive Web App - gyakorlatilag egy weboldal olyan kiterjesztése, meghosszabbítása, amivel az nem csak böngészőben lesz elérhető, hanem letölthető formában is, ami lehetővé teszi annak további hasznos funkicókkal való felruházását. Például egy PWA tud offline, internet nélküli módban is működni, ami nem jellemző egy weboldalra.
A megszokott az a hagyományos mobilapp, amit az alkalmazás áruházakból lehet telepíteni, onan kapja a frissítést is, van olyan termék/szolgáltatás, amely esetében még mindig ez a legjobb megoldás, de érdemes a PWA mobilappon elgondolkodni, mert:
- Általában, ha már van egy weboldal, akkor abból könnyedén lehet PWA appot készíteni.
- Nem kell az alkalmazás áruház folyamatain végigmenni, hanem bármit publikálhatunk ebben a formában.
- Ha bármit változtatunk, akkor nem szükséges új verziót kiadni, az automatikusan frissül.
És a legfontosabb, ami miatt ez a poszt született, hogy a különböző robotknak, akik elérhetővé teszik a tartalmainkat a keresőkben és onnan ingyenes látogatókra tehetünk szert nem tudják az appok tartalmait feltérképezni és igaz ez ai eszközökre is. Miért fontos ez? Ha PWA appunk van. (és a weboldal, amiből létrehoztuk publikus, vagy ha nem is publikus de adtunk hozzáférést a robotoknak, akkor bekerülhetnek a keresőkbe és az AI eszközökbe, ahonnan ingyenes látogatókat szerezhetünk. És azért hagsúlyozzuk ennyire az AI eszközöket is, mert a legújabb kutatás szerint a weboldalak 63%-nak már van AI látogatói forgalma: https://ahrefs.com/blog/ai-traffic-study/ , amitől a hagyományos appok elesnek.
Nem minden esetben a PWA a megoldás, de a legtöbb általános felhasználásra elég jó, és több előnye is jelentkezik, figyelembe véve, hogy a böngészőben is egyre több szolgáltatás érhető el, így például a helymeghatározás és különböző engedélyek pl kamerahasználat stb sem lehetetlen már, ha UG azaz felhasználó által generált tartalomra lenne szükség. De a mrketingszempontból az egyik legfontosabb, az értesítés is megvalósítható PWA esetében is.
Azt is érdemes számításba venni, hogy amennyiben a weboldalunk elég gyors, erről több bejegyzés is született már az oldalunkon, akkor a PWA alkalmazásunk is gyorsan fog letöltődni és annak használata is gyors lesz. Ezzel eljuttunk oda, hogy azokon az eszközökön i használható lesz az alkalmazásunk, amelyekre esetleg már nincs elérhető alkalmazásáruház, vagy a nem szeretnénk a különböző operációs rendszerek különböző verzióira appot karbantartani, mert így csupán a "weboldaunkat" kell gondoznunk.
Az érdekesség kedvéért a funkció lista helyett álljon itt egy lista, hogy mi mindent tudtak eddig PWA alapon megvalósítani: https://github.com/hemanth/awesome-pwa